Web10 Apr 2024 · The Scottish Courts and Tribunal Service has been working to reduce it so that there are no more than 20,000 scheduled cases being prepared for trial. The number peaked in January 2024 at over 43,000 and has since been cut substantially, but it’s likely to take another year before the Covid-related backlog of summary trials (for lesser ... WebThe Gender Recognition Reform (Scotland) Bill has been introduced to Parliament. The Gender Recognition Act 2004 sets out the current process for gender recognition, which applies across the UK. The Equality Act 2010 makes it generally unlawful to discriminate against people who have a “protected characteristic”, as defined under the Act.
